Over-the-Top Tailgate Theme Ideas That Pull a Crowd

The setups people walk over to see almost always have a theme. A clear idea, run all the way to the edge, is what turns a parking spot into the one everybody films. These over-the-top tailgate theme ideas give the loudest superfans a direction to build around, and every one of them plays well with a fistful of throws.

Go all-in on your two team colors

The simplest theme is also one of the strongest. Pick your team's two colors and let nothing escape them, from the canopy to the cups to the crew's shirts. A setup drenched in matching color reads from across the lot and photographs loud, which is exactly what makes people stop.

Build a rig with height and sound

A flag on a tall pole and a speaker in the truck bed do more than any banner. Height gives people a landmark to walk toward, and sound gives them a reason to stay. Add a themed centerpiece, whether that is a painted truck, an inflatable, or a wall of team flags, and you have a setup that owns its corner of the lot.

Make the toss the centerpiece

Whatever theme you pick, the moment that travels is the throw. Time it for when the lot is full, get the whole crew in frame, and sling beads out to people you have never met. A shower of throws over a themed setup is the clip that gets shared long after the final whistle.
